Highly Detailed Sheet Metal Fabrication with Fiber Laser Cutting

Fiber laser cutting has revolutionized sheet sheet metal fabrication industry. With its remarkable accuracy, fiber lasers can produce incredibly complex cuts in a variety of materials, including steel, aluminum, and copper. This technology offers numerous advantages over traditional cutting methods such as plasma or waterjet cutting. Fiber laser cutting provides cleaner/smoother/more refined edge finishes, reduces material waste, and allows for faster/rapid/quick production times.

Additionally, fiber lasers can achieve high cutting speeds while maintaining exceptional accuracy, making them ideal for applications requiring mass production.

Automated Fiber Laser Welding: Joining Metal Seamlessly

Automated fiber laser welding has become a cutting-edge technology revolutionizing the way metals are joined. This process harnesses the immense power of high-energy fiber lasers to melt and fuse metal pieces together, creating incredibly strong and durable bonds. Unlike traditional welding methods, fiber laser welding offers unparalleled precision and control, enabling intricate designs and minimal heat-affected zones. This leads to a highly refined weld with exceptional surface quality, reducing the need for post-weld finishing operations.

Fiber laser welding's versatility extends across diverse click here industries, from automotive and aerospace to electronics and medical device manufacturing. Its ability to handle a wide range of metals, including carbon steel, makes it an ideal choice for complex fabrication tasks. Furthermore, the inherent speed and efficiency of this process contribute to reduced production times and improved overall manufacturing productivity.
